Unraveling History at Hedemora Gammelgard
Located in Hedemora, Sweden, this local museum provides a deep dive into the region's rich history and culture. Did you know it features artifacts dating back centuries?
Founded in 2010 by local historians, Hedemora Gammelgard is housed in a historic building that reflects traditional Swedish architecture. The museum plays a crucial role in preserving local heritage, showcasing everything from agricultural tools to traditional clothing.
